Breast Most cancers Cryoablation
Overview

Cryoablation is emerging being a promising remedy for breast most cancers, particularly for compact tumors. It requires the use of Severe cold (liquid nitrogen or argon fuel) to freeze and destroy cancerous tissues. This procedure is minimally invasive, executed less than imaging steerage (commonly ultrasound), and might be an alternative to operation for chosen individuals.

Benefits

Minimally Invasive: Preserves encompassing healthful tissues and minimizes write-up-operative difficulties.

Rapid Restoration: Normally permits more quickly Restoration in comparison with traditional operation.

Outpatient Process: Generally performed being an outpatient process, reducing healthcare facility stays.

Varicose Vein Therapy with Laser
Overview

Laser treatment method (Endovenous Laser Ablation or EVLA) is a minimally invasive method utilised to deal with varicose veins. A laser fiber is inserted to the vein underneath ultrasound steerage, offering laser Electrical power that heats and seals the vein shut. This closes from the defective vein, redirecting blood circulation to healthier veins.

Rewards

Non-Surgical: No need to have for incisions; method performed via a compact puncture.

Thyroid Nodule Microwave Ablation
Overview

Microwave ablation (MWA) is utilized for dealing with benign thyroid nodules that cause signs or symptoms or cosmetic worries. It involves inserting a microwave antenna to the nodule less than ultrasound assistance. Microwaves warmth and demolish the nodule's tissue, reducing its size or eliminating it altogether.

Positive aspects

Exact Focusing on: Targets precise nodules though preserving bordering balanced thyroid tissue.

Quick Process: Usually performed being an outpatient technique with small recovery time.

Possible Alternative to Surgical procedure: Provides a substitute for surgical procedures for clients who are not candidates for medical procedures or choose much less invasive solutions.

Ultrasound-Guided Biopsy
Overview

Ultrasound-guided biopsy can be a diagnostic process applied to obtain tissue samples from suspicious regions discovered on ultrasound imaging. A biopsy needle is guided by actual-time ultrasound images to target the exact place of issue, ensuring correct sampling for pathological Investigation.

Benefits

Accuracy: Gives exact focusing on of suspicious regions, improving upon diagnostic precision.

Minimally Invasive: Avoids the necessity for more invasive techniques for tissue sampling.

Swift Effects: Allows speedy pathology effects, facilitating timely remedy organizing.
